Course Content

• Introduction to IoT Architectures for Smart Factories
• IoT Protocols: MQTT, CoAP, and AMQP for Industrial Applications
• Sensor Networks and Data Acquisition in Smart Manufacturing
• Security in Industrial IoT (IIoT) and Smart Factory Environments
• Cloud Platforms and Data Analytics for Smart Factories
• Implementing and Managing IoT Gateways for Industrial Settings
• Industrial Communication Networks (Ethernet/IP, PROFINET)
• IoT Protocols for Smart Factories: Case Studies and Best Practices

Career Role (IoT Protocols & Smart Factories) Description
IoT Software Engineer (Smart Factory) Develops and maintains software for IoT devices and systems within smart factories, focusing on protocol integration (MQTT, CoAP, AMQP) and data management.
Industrial IoT Consultant (Smart Manufacturing) Advises companies on implementing IoT solutions in their manufacturing processes, specializing in protocol optimization and cybersecurity for smart factories.
IoT Network Engineer (Smart Factory Automation) Designs, implements, and manages network infrastructure for IoT devices in smart factories, ensuring seamless communication using various protocols (e.g., Modbus, OPC UA).
Data Scientist (Smart Factory Analytics) Analyzes massive datasets generated by IoT devices in smart factories, extracting insights to optimize processes and predict equipment failures. Requires strong IoT protocol understanding for data interpretation.
